Authorities say five students at an upstate New York community college were stabbed during a fight at
an off-campus party, but their injuries aren't serious.
Vincent Begley, a Sullivan County Community College spokesman,
says the stabbings happened early Friday morning in the hamlet of
Loch Sheldrake.
Begley says the party was at the Edgewood Dorms, a privately
owned rental complex. He says some students live there, but it
isn't affiliated with the college.
He says four students were treated at a local hospital and
released. A fifth suffered facial cuts and was transferred to
Westchester Medical Center.
Police haven't released any other information about the fight or
how it started.
